Topic: Safest way to remove light rust spots on bandsaw table?
Replies: 9
Views: 2908

Re: Safest way to remove light rust spots on bandsaw table?

I have tried Evaporust and other stuff. The cheapest and best I've found is Barkeeper's Friend (make a soft paste - thicker than slurry) and rub it on with a cloth and then off. I easily turned black way tubes to silver. I keep a small plastic container in the cabinet under the SS for easy access.

Topic: Another 10ER reborn into this filthy world.
Replies: 28
Views: 4119

Re: Another 10ER reborn into this filthy world.

Another thing you can use is oxalic acid. Add it to water, stir and soak the parts. Don't use a power tool with a brush as it creates fumes you do not want to breathe. This is the main ingredient in Barkeeper's Friend. I created a paste to remove black rust from way tubes as well as red/brown rust f...
